Superhigh-frequency deflector-shaper for short electron bunches

Description

A resonator-deflector by means of which an accelerated electron beam bunched in short bunches is shaped in a sequence of beam current pulses with regulated duration and nano- and picosecond frequency is described. The resonator consists of a case, waveguide section with flanges, movable tuning piston, copper flange 1 mm hick, in which joint hole is made. The flange is chucked between two waveguide flanges and has indium seals on both sides. The joint element is removable, and this simplifies the resonator tuning. The resonator can be retuned in the frequency range of 2690 MHz-2890 MHz by a throttle piston
